Three-day ‘Nruthyopasana 2019’ begins in city

1 min read

Mysuru: Nruthyopasana, a dance festival has started in the city on Saturday. The three day festival will be held till July 15 at two different venues- Nadabrahma Sangeeth Sabha on JLB road and Kalamandira in the city.

The festival in its seventh year is organised on account of 15th anniversary of Kala Sandesha Prathishtan.

Artists Pooja Dev and Dr Gunasheela Harsha performing Bharatanatya.

A dance performance ‘Bharatanatya Marga’ by the senior disciples of the Prathishtan Pooja Dev and Dr Gunasheela Harsha marked the inauguration of the festival at Nadabrahma Sangeet Sabha.

The artists enthralled the art cognoscentis with their performance.

Vidushi Kanchana S Sriranjini rendered vocal, with K Sandesh Bhargav on natuvanga, H L Shivashankar Swamy on mridanga, Narayan on violin and V P Venugoplan on flute.

Music exponent Dr Sukanya Prabhakar inaugurated the festival in the presence of Joint Director of Kannada and Culture Department V N Mallikarjun Swamy and Prathishtan’s president Dr D Umapathy, according to a press release by its executive committee member Kavya Raveesh Renjala.
